Could Edible Photonic Structures Be an Alternative to Traditional Food Coloring?
What if color in food came from photonic structures? This perspective introduces structural color as a potential next‐generation solution to replace conventional colorants in foods. It discusses edible photonic materials, their unique benefits, and the technological, safety, and consumer acceptance challenges that must be addressed to bring this ...

Domino Synthesis of Functionalized Cyclic Acetals From Organic Carbonates
Cyclic carbonates equipped with acrylic functional groups are shown to undergo a domino process in the presence of a suitable alkoxide to deliver novel types of decorated cyclic acetals. The developed protocol combines practical conditions and a wide scope and features a new reactivity modus for these carbon dioxide‐derived heterocyclic precursors.

Corn Zein Nanocarriers for Agrochemical Delivery and Smart Packaging
This review explores zein, a corn‐derived biodegradable protein, as a multifunctional nanocarrier for sustainable agriculture and packaging. It examines advances in agrochemical delivery, smart packaging, and stimuli‐responsive systems, while addressing scalability, environmental fate, and regulatory barriers.
